Debian系统下MongoDB性能如何
Debian系统下MongoDB性能受硬件、配置、索引等因素影响,以下是关键信息:
- 硬件配置:使用SSD可显著提升读写速度,足够内存能减少磁盘I/O,多核CPU可提高并发处理能力。
- 配置优化:
- 编辑
/etc/mongod.conf
,调整storage.wiredTiger.engineConfig.cacheSizeGB
(建议设为物理内存60%-80%)。 - 启用副本集和分片可提升读写性能与可扩展性。
- 编辑
- 索引策略:为常用查询字段创建单字段或复合索引,使用覆盖索引减少文档访问,定期清理冗余索引。
- 查询优化:利用投影限制返回字段,使用聚合框架处理复杂数据,避免全表扫描和深度翻页。
- 监控工具:使用
mongostat
、mongotop
或第三方工具(如PMM)实时监控性能指标,分析慢查询并优化。
合理优化后,Debian上的MongoDB可满足多数场景的性能需求,具体效果需结合业务负载调整。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!